Description:
Molded pearlware plate with slightly scalloped edge printed with underglaze blue with "willow pattern"; central view of Chinese pagoda on river with bridge and three figures on it, boat in water, two lovebirds above.
Gallery Label:
According to accession records, this dish was in the Muzzey Tavern and was sold to Muzzey to the Buckmans shortly before the Revolution.
